The education marks of the Grade 9 students decide whether they can enter key high school or not, and even will have an indirect influence on their developmental direction. Therefore, how to improve Grade 9 students scores has become a hot topic in school education and family education as well. Among the acquired factors which influence marks, self-learning abilities matter most.The study researched the self-learning condition of 546 students from Zhenheng Middle School, which also look into the relationship between their self-learning abilities and marks, with the reference of Primary and Middle School Students Self-learning Scale Forms by Professor Pang Weiguo.This study draws conclusions as follows:1. Self abilities are at the middle or even lower level and differ a lot in different classes, genders and study levels.2. Self–learning abilities are in direct ratio to their marks. The former have prediction to the latter.3. Study motives are in direct ratio to study strategies. The former can elaborate 36.7% changes of the latter.4. Self-learning abilities and marks with the result of different self-learning abilities manifest differently among different classes, genders and study levels.
